IUB introduces Robotics and Automation Society

IEEE Robotics and Automation Society (RAS) IUB Student Branch Chapter officially begins its journey at Independent University, Bangladesh (IUB) after a grand opening ceremony on Tuesday.

The RAS branch chapter was officially inaugurated by the country’s first andro-humanoid NAO robot of EEE department of IUB. Dr Md Abdur Razzak, the branch mentor of IEEE IUB Student Branch welcomed the audience and was present on the occasion as the chief guest. Dr Mustafa Habib Chowdhury, the branch counselor was present as the guest of honour while Dr Lamia Iftekhar, the vice-chair (activity) of Women in Engineering Affinity Group, IEEE Bangladesh Section was present on the occasion as the special guest. Nasfikur Rahman Khan, the advisor of IEEE RAS IUB Student Branch Chapter also spoke on the occasion. The 4-member executive committee of IEEE RAS IUB Student Branch Chapter comprising the Chair, Vice-Chair, Secretary and Treasurer were introduced by the RAS advisor. After the inauguration, the audience enjoyed the performance of NAO robot. A six-wheeled bomb defusal robot was also showcased along with NAO’s performance.
